Summary
Enables protein domain specific binding activity. Involved in negative regulation of transcription by RNA polymerase II; protein export from nucleus; and response to xenobiotic stimulus. Predicted to be located in several cellular components, including annulate lamellae; kinetochore; and nucleus. Predicted to be part of ribonucleoprotein complex. Predicted to be active in cytoplasm and nucleus. Orthologous to human XPO1 (exportin 1). [provided by Alliance of Genome Resources, Apr 2022]
